A Roda is a Bronze Age stone circle located in the municipality of , in , . It is the first structure of this kind —a henge, an almost circular or oval structure consisting of a hollow surrounded by a ditch and an embankment— to be discovered and investigated on the , although similar structures have since been identified in other parts of Galicia. is situated 2½ km east of Millares.
